How much does plan management through KURRAJONG WARATAH cost?
By NDIS regulation, plan management fees are paid from a dedicated Improved Life Choices line item in your plan. You do not pay KURRAJONG WARATAH directly — there is no out-of-pocket cost to participants.

Can I switch to a different plan manager?
Yes. Switching plan managers is free and does not require an NDIS plan review. You can change at any time by providing written notice to your current provider, then signing with your new plan manager. KURRAJONG WARATAH can assist with the transition process.
